Scottish Power broke into non-electricity markets largely through merger and acquisition. Consequently, the business units within the company utilized a multitude of systems implemented on different operating systems and hardware platforms in a distributed computing environment. As a result of corporate growth, Scottish Power therefore faced the challenge of integrating MVS, AIX and Solaris operating systems with Oracle, Sybase and DB2 databases, while also maintaining the integrity and consistency of the data. Recognizing that continued corporate growth was only possible if information could be viewed as a single resource, Scottish Power implemented an integration mechanism to support the sharing of corporate data and the exchange of information across the enterprise.
